Understanding Template Engines
Template engines work by allowing developers to define a layout for their web pages, separating the design from the content. This is similar to how your car’s dashboard displays information while keeping the engine compartment hidden. The engine processes data and generates the final HTML that users see in their browsers. This separation of concerns makes it easier to manage and update web applications, just as regular maintenance keeps your car running smoothly.

Pug for Complex Applications
Pug, formerly known as Jade, is often recommended for more complex applications that require a high level of customization. A financial services company utilized Pug to build a dashboard for their clients. The developers appreciated its ability to create clean, concise code, which made maintaining the application easier over time.

Community and Support
The strength of the community around a template engine can significantly impact its usability and longevity. Here are some facts regarding community support:
- Handlebars has a large community with extensive documentation, making it easier for newcomers to find resources and solutions.
- EJS benefits from a strong GitHub presence, with numerous contributors and a wealth of open-source projects utilizing the engine.
- Pug has a dedicated user base, and its documentation includes many examples and tutorials to assist developers.
- Nunjucks, while smaller in community size, is backed by Mozilla, lending it credibility and support.
